Manual Fruit Tree Pollination -Part 2

This is the second installment of my three-part series on manual pollination in Japan from the upcoming feature, “WWOOF! The Movie”. It reveals the way in which pollen is extracted from the anthers of the apple (or any other fruit) flower through a special grinding mechanism.
